Transaction 64c60a136a71146cd9b4a585f048d30d28fdb5771e298c954535d195486fb78d
1 Input
1 Output
-
64c60a136a71146cd9b4a585f048d30d28fdb5771e298c954535d195486fb78d:0
- value
- 71585
- script pubkey
- OP_0 OP_PUSHBYTES_20 6508d5c132fdae34dc6a6e0c048d7cec24e171a4
- address
- bc1qv5ydtsfjlkhrfhr2dcxqfrtuasjwzudyekjvvt